At the Aug. 6 meeting the Board voted to accept two donations under Policy 3280 (Gifts, Grants, Bequests): a monetary donation for girls' tennis team jackets and an in‑kind donation of tree removal services that assisted district facilities work. Susan Wheeler moved to accept the donations and Scott Pottbecker seconded; the motion passed unanimously.

The in‑kind tree removal was noted in Superintendent Jeffrey Villar's update as having been supported by the Town of Litchfield to aid the Lakeview High School parking‑lot work. The acceptance was presented as compliant with Policy 3280 and recorded by the Board in the meeting minutes.
